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Darkling beetle | Eld's Deer |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Coleoptera (Beetles) | Artiodactyla (Even-toed Ungulates) |
| Family | Tenebrionidae | Cervidae (Deer) |
| Genus | Tribolium | Rucervus |
| Species | Tribolium destructor | Rucervus eldii |
